In the context of this Lab Report, it is imperative to define the role of an Optometrist accurately. An Optometrist is a healthcare professional who provides primary vision care, including vision testing and correction, diagnosis and treatment of eye diseases and injuries, and prescription of corrective lenses. Unlike ophthalmologists who are medical doctors capable of performing surgery, optometrists focus on non-surgical management of eye health. However, the distinction is becoming increasingly fluid as scope-of-practice laws evolve globally.
In Egypt Alexandria specifically, the role has expanded significantly due to urbanization and lifestyle changes. The city’s unique climate—characterized by high humidity, salt air from the Mediterranean Sea, and intense sunlight exposure—creates specific environmental stressors on ocular health. Consequently, an Optometrist in this region must be equipped to handle conditions exacerbated by these local factors, such as dry eye syndrome caused by sea breeze and sun glare, or allergic conjunctivitis triggered by regional pollen counts.

1. Visual Acuity and Refraction Analysis
The foundational step in any Optometrist consultation is the assessment of visual acuity. In Alexandria, where digital screen usage among students and professionals has skyrocketed, myopia (nearsightedness) rates have shown a concerning upward trend. The Lab Report documents the use of automated refractors followed by subjective refraction using a phoropter to determine the precise prescription for glasses or contact lenses. Special attention is paid to astigmatism, which is prevalent among young adults in urban centers like Egypt Alexandria due to prolonged near-work activities.
2. Slit-Lamp Biomicroscopy
The slit-lamp examination is a critical tool for the Optometrist. In this Lab Report, we detail how this instrument allows for the magnified inspection of the anterior segment of the eye, including the cornea, iris, and lens. Given Alexandria’s humid climate and occasional air pollution issues from industrial areas along the coast, an Optometrist must carefully examine patients for signs of environmental keratitis or particulate matter deposition on the corneal surface. This examination is vital for detecting early signs of cataracts and corneal abrasions.
3. Intraocular Pressure Measurement (Tonometry)
Glaucoma, often referred to as the "silent thief of sight," is a significant public health concern in Egypt. The Lab Report emphasizes the routine use of non-contact tonometry or applanation tonometry by an Optometrist to measure intraocular pressure. Early detection of elevated pressure allows for timely intervention, preventing irreversible optic nerve damage. This preventive measure is particularly crucial in Alexandria’s aging population.
4. Fundus Examination
Dilated fundus examination allows the Optometrist to visualize the retina, optic disc, and blood vessels at the back of the eye. In Egypt Alexandria, where diabetes prevalence is relatively high, screening for diabetic retinopathy is a key component of optometric care. The Lab Report notes that an Optometrist plays a pivotal role in identifying microaneurysms and hemorrhages associated with diabetes before they reach the stage requiring laser surgery by an ophthalmologist.

The Lab Report also acknowledges the technological advancements integrated into Optometrist practices in Alexandria. Tele-optometry is emerging as a viable option for follow-up consultations, particularly beneficial for patients living in remote parts of Greater Alexandria who may find travel difficult. Furthermore, the integration of digital retinal cameras allows Optometrists to store high-resolution images for longitudinal tracking of conditions like glaucoma and diabetic retinopathy. This technological adoption ensures that an Optometrist in Egypt Alexandria is not only clinically proficient but also technologically adept, bridging the gap between traditional examination methods and modern diagnostic precision.
Despite the advancements, several challenges persist for an Optometrist operating in this region. One significant issue is the lack of public awareness regarding regular eye check-ups. Many residents of Alexandria visit an eye specialist only when vision loss has already occurred. The Lab Report recommends intensified community outreach programs led by local Optometrists to educate the public on preventive care.
Another recommendation involves standardizing optometric education and continuing professional development within Egypt Alexandria. Ensuring that all practicing Optometrists have access to the latest training in managing complex ocular diseases will enhance the overall quality of care. Collaboration with ophthalmologists is also encouraged to create a seamless referral system, ensuring that patients requiring surgical intervention receive timely care without compromising their overall eye health.
